The hotel was excellent in all aspects except the points I make below which really did spoil our stay at this otherwise excellent hotel. Is the catering in this hotel contracted out? If so change the contractor or if the hotel staff are responsible then sack them.
We booked a table for five and opted for a set menu plus wine.
Three courses were on this set menu
primi - seafood and rocket pasta - it was ok
secondi - turbot and potato
dessert - something I did not understand.
The primi was ok except for the fact that one of our group has a seafood allergy and requested a primi without seafood. All the staff did was pick out the seafood from the dish and sent it out as seafood free. In fact they had not even removed all the seafood and in any case even if they had then it would still give an allergic reaction from the juices.
Now to the secondi- 1 leaf of lettuce with three thin - very thin - like potato crisp thin - pieces of fried potato covering a very - very -very small sliver of fish. The secondi food tasted fine but the quantity was tiny.
We then had dessert and it was fine - chocolate mousse for two and icecream for the other. It was fine but when we came to pay we discovered that this was not the dessert on the set menu.We had not been offered the desserts on the set menu and thought we had been given them
The wine cost 16 euro a bottle for some plonk.
Overall: Absolutely disppointed at the experience of the evening meal - otherwise fine 1 Portions of secondi were a joke - I mean really small and 1 leaf of lettuce 2 Charged for desserts and not offered the desserts on set menu 3 Absolutely dangerous presentation of seafood to a person with an allergy - this can kill such a person - please see to this if nothing else (107834305)
The service at the hotel was very good - as were the staff at the beach bar. English was not widely spoken but with a little sign language and patience (from the staff) we were able to ask for most things
The resort was closing down for the end of the season (6th September) which was miss leading when Active Hotels told us that there were only 2 rooms left in the hotel!
Whilst tennis courts were advertised the hotel did not have any racquets to hire which seemed rather limiting I would imagine for most guests holidaying from outside Italy
Overall: An acceptable 3 star hotel, good service, when in season I would imagine the hotel could have a nice ambience and atmosphere. (107122917)
